Trouble Shooting
I
f you are experiencing trouble with the LCD display refer to the following. If the
problem persists please contact your local dealer or our service center.
The monitor does not
respond after you turn on
the system.
Check if the monitor is turned on.
Turn off the power and check the monitor power
cord and signal cable are properly connected.
The characters on the
screen are dim.
Refer to the Controls and Adjustments section to
adjust the brightness (BRIGHTNESS on the OSD
sub-menu.) .
The screen is blank.
During use the monitor screen may automatically
turn off as a result of the Power Saving feature.
Press any key to see if the screen comes back.
Refer to the Controls and Adjustments section to
adjust the brightness (BRIGHTNESS on the OSD
sub-menu.) .
The screen flashes when
it initializes.
Turn off the monitor and turn it on again.
Refer to the Controls and Adjustments section to
reload the default setting (RESET on the OSD
main-menu.) .
Partial image or
incorrectly displayed
image
Check to see if the resolution of your computer is
higher than that of the LCD display.
Reconfigure the resolution of your computer to
make it less than or equal to 1024 x 768.
Image has vertical line
bars
Use "Size" to make an adjustment.
Check and reconfigure the display mode of the
vertical refresh rate of your graphic card to make
it compatible with the LCD display.
